
Corentin Moutet gets the better of Clement Tabur 6-3 7-6(6) 6-3 in the 1st round in Paris on Tuesday in what was an all-French player clash. Moutet will engage against Novak Djokovic in the 2nd round. The match lasted 2 hours and 53 minutes. His best achievement in this event was reaching the 4th round in 2024. At the end of the match, Moutet scored 118 points vs. Clement’s 102.
Moutet
Corentin was sharp when converting 55% of the break points that he procured (6/11).
Tabur
On the other side, Tabur was far from perfect in converting his break points (only 20% – 2/10). That was one of the key issues for his loss.
After this match, the head to head between Moutet and Tabur is 1-0 for Corentin.

Moutet will fight against Djokovic in the 2nd round.
This will be the 3rd time that Corentin Moutet and Novak Djokovic fight against each other. The head to head is 2-0 for Djokovic (see full H2H stats), 1-0 on clay.
